Stock markets advance in early trade on buying in realty, utility stocks

Mumbai, Oct 10 (PTI) Benchmark Sensex rose by nearly 300 points while Nifty traded above the 25,250 level in the early session on Friday, following buying in realty and utilities stocks. The 30-share BSE Sensex jumped 299.21 points or 0.36 per cent to 82,471.31 in the morning trade. The NSE Nifty increased by 70.05 points or 0.28 per cent to 25,251.85. Among Sensex firms, Power Grid, Adani Ports, Axis Bank, State Bank of India, NTPC, Asian Paints, ITC, HDFC Bank, Bharat Electronics Ltd, and Titan were the major gainers. Starmer, Modi promise to deepen ties on trade, jobs and education

NEW DELHI: In a strong push for business expansion, job creation, and education partnerships, Prime Minister Narendra Modi and his British counterpart Keir Starmer on Thursday reiterated their commitment to unlocking the full potential of the recently signed IndiaUK Comprehensive Economic and Trade Agreement (CETA). Meeting in Mumbai, the two leaders jointly addressed the CEO Summit and the Global Fintech Fest, laying out a clear vision for strengthening economic ties and catalysing growth in key sectors, including tech, finance, clean energy, and education. Starmers two-day visit, his first as prime minister, comes as both nations move swiftly to operationalise the landmark Free Trade Agreement (FTA), signed in July. Our deal with India means more investment in the UK and thousands of new jobs across the country, Starmer said. Modi echoed that sentiment, saying the CETA would create new job opportunities for youth, expand trade and benefit both our industries as well as consumers. He highlighted Indias favourable business climate, citing policy stability, predictable regulations, and strong domestic demand as key advantages. He talked of the prospects of joint ventures. We see immense potential for partnerships in telecom, artificial intelligence, biotechnology, quantum computing, semiconductors, cyber, and space. In defence, we are moving towards co-design and co-production models. This is the moment to accelerate and convert these opportunities into tangible outcomes. Ahead of the leaders meeting, Commerce and Industry Minister Piyush Goyal and UK Business and Trade Secretary Peter Kyle finalised the institutional framework for the deals delivery, repositioning the Joint Economic and Trade Committee (JETCO) as the central body to oversee implementation and resolve regulatory and market access issues. Modi also announced that nine British universities will open campuses in India. Starmer confirmed that the University of Lancaster and the University of Surrey have already received approval. International education brought into the UK over 32 billion in 2022. Nearly 1 billion of that came from international campuses. Meanwhile, Air India and IndiGo are expanding flight frequencies to the UK. British Airways announced it will add a third daily flight between Delhi and Heathrow by 2026, subject to clearancessignalling growing trade and travel demand. Earlier, a British delegation visited the Yash Raj Films studio in Mumbai to explore joint production opportunities between Bollywood and the British film industry. As the CETA enters its implementation phase, both governments are betting on it as a vehicle for growth, innovation, and jobs across both economies.

Mumbai's Aqua Line makes history: India's longest underground metro roars to life with 1.5L riders on Day 1

Mumbai's Aqua Line (Metro 3) has finally opened its entire 33.5km underground corridor, connecting Aarey to Cuffe Parade. The line saw a massive 1,46,087 commuters by 9 pm on its opening day, significantly cutting travel time and costs for residents. This fully underground corridor is now Mumbai's first and the country's longest constructed in one go.

Maharashtra MoS in trouble for issuing gun license to local rowdy despite police's negative report

MUMBAI: Maharashtra home minister for the state and Shiv Sena MLA Yogesh Kadam landed into trouble over permitting a gun license to infamous rowdy Nilesh Ghayawal, despite receiving a negative report from the local police. Oppositions demanded an inquiry and the resignation of Minister Yogesh Kadam. Nilesh Ghayawals brother, Sachin Ghayawal, had sought a gun license. There are serious criminal charges against Ghahayal. The local Police in its report said that the court has not exonerated the charges against Sachin Ghayawal, but the charges are of a serious nature; therefore, the gun license should not be issued to Ghayawal. His brother Nilesh Ghayahal has been absconding and declared a fugitive. Shiv Sena (UBT) leader Anil Parab alleged that the home minister for the state, Yogesh Kadam, has no moral right and authority to remain in the minister's chair. He said he had already submitted the complaint to Chief Minister Devendra Fadnavis, but he is not taking action; therefore, they had no option but to approach the court. CM Devendra Fadnavis should sack Mr Kadam and save the image of his government; otherwise court will force him to take Mr Kadams resignation. The strictures passed by the court will be against the government and the chief minister as well. Therefore, it is the right time to show the moral authority and save the image of the government, Parab said. Breaking the silence, Shiv Sena minister Yogesh Kadam said that the gun licenses are issued by the police commissioner. He said he, as a minister, only signs the papers that are submitted to him. As per submitted documents, there are no present charges against Mr Ghayahal; therefore, he is not guilty of the issuance of a gun license. Besides, the applicant who is seeking a gun license had not seen his relationship with anyone, like his brother and sisters. The report of the applicant is important. The factual details are a key factor while issuing the license, Kadam. Kadam, defending Ghayawal, said that the charges against Ghayawal were 10-15 years ago; however, today there are no charges against him at all. Ramdas Kadam, father of Yogesh Kadam, said that the gun license was issued on the recommendation of one of the senior members of the Maharashtra state legislative council; therefore, there is no point in accusing his son. Prithvi Shaw, Jalaj Saxena Named In Ankeet Bawane-led Maharashtra Ranji Trophy Squad

Maharashtra Ranji Trophy: India batter Prithvi Shaw and seasoned domestic all-rounder Jalaj Saxena have been included in Maharashtras 16-member squad for the upcoming Ranji Trophy 2025-26 season, which begins on October 15. The state selectors appointed Ankeet Bawane as the full-time captain for the campaign, with Maharashtra set to face Kerala in their opening fixture in Thiruvananthapuram from October 15-18. Shaw, who switched from Mumbai ahead of the season, is aiming for a fresh start after a turbulent period that saw him lose his place in the red-ball setup. His move to Maharashtra is seen as a significant step in trying to revive his red-ball career. Meanwhile, Saxena, one of the most consistent all-rounders in domestic cricket, joins the squad after a long stint with Kerala, where he played a key role in their run to the Ranji final last season. He was part of the team that played a warm-up match against his old team, Mumbai, in which he got into a heated confrontation with Musheer Khan, raising his bat to nearly hit Musheer. Shaw is in good form as he scored 181 against Mumbai. India international Ruturaj Gaikwad, a regular feature in Maharashtras setup and a former captain, is also part of the squad. The selectors have leaned on experience, picking Pradeep Dadhe over young fast bowler Rajvardhan Hangargekar. In the previous Ranji season (2024-25), Maharashtra finished fifth in Elite Group A, managing two wins, two draws, and three losses from seven matches.
